Hello - I will be traveling with a 2 year old and older elderly parents on a cruise to Alaska. We decided to stay in Vancover a couple of days before our Cruise. Is there any suggestions on what we should definitly do. Probably should know that one of the parents has a walker that she will be using. We haven't been yet, but in my research I think that the Vancouver Trolley would work for you. It does circles of the city and it's a hop on/hop off thing where you can get off when you want. And I don't you literally have to hop.
